npm 包 powsrv.js 使用教程

阅读时长 3 分钟读完

简介

powsrv.js 是一个基于 Node.js 的命令行工具,可以帮助我们快速搭建一个静态服务器并进行本地开发,支持 Live Reload、GZip 压缩等功能。在前端开发中,使用 powsrv.js 可以极大地提高我们的开发效率。

安装

首先需要安装 Node.js 和 npm,如果还没有安装的话,可以到 Node.js 官网进行下载并按照提示安装。

安装完成后,在命令行执行以下命令来安装 powsrv.js:

使用

使用 powsrv.js 命令启动服务器很简单,只需要进入项目的根目录,然后执行以下命令:

执行完这个命令后,powsrv.js 会在当前目录启动一个服务器,并监听 8000 端口。如果当前目录下有 index.html 文件的话,powsrv.js 会自动将它作为首页来访问。

除了启动服务器外,powsrv.js 还提供了一些其他的命令,如:

指定端口

默认情况下,powsrv.js 会监听 8000 端口,如果需要指定监听的端口,可以使用以下命令:

这样就可以指定 powsrv.js 监听 8080 端口。

Live Reload

powsrv.js 支持 Live Reload,也就是说,当我们修改了文件保存后,服务器会自动刷新页面。启用 Live Reload 非常简单,只需要在命令后面加上 --livereload 参数:

这样就可以启用 Live Reload 功能了。

GZip 压缩

powsrv.js 还支持 GZip 压缩,可以减小文件传输大小,提高网站性能。启用 GZip 压缩也很简单,只需要在命令后面加上 --gzip 参数:

这样就可以启用 GZip 压缩功能了。

示例代码

以下是一个示例代码,启动 powsrv.js 后,可以在浏览器中访问 http://127.0.0.1:8000/index.html 进行预览。

-- -------------------- ---- -------
--------- -----
------
------
  ----- ----------------
  ---------------- ----------
-------
------
  ---------- -----------
  ------- -----------------------
-------
-------

结语

powsrv.js 是一个非常实用的前端工具,它可以帮助我们快速搭建一个静态服务器并进行本地开发,支持 Live Reload、GZip 压缩等功能,非常适合前端开发使用。希望本文能够对大家有所帮助!

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6006735a890c4f7277583eee

纠错
反馈